Procedure for testing Presence of Vanaspati and Rancidity in Ghee?
Carry out the steps enumerated herewith for conducting this exercise.
For Vanaspati Checking:
1. Take 5 ml of ghee in a stoppered test tube.
2. Add 5 ml of concentrated HCl and shake.
3. Add 5 ml of 2% furfural solution and shake. Observe for the colour in acid layer.
4. Development of pink colour in acid layer indicates the presence of vanaspati.
